POLICE have traced the mother of a newborn baby found dead on a supermarket car park in Bilston today.

Officers were alerted by a member of the public who made the tragic discovery at the car park of Morrisons on the Black Country Route just after 9am this morning (Sunday April 11).

A spokesman for West Midlands Police had said earlier today: "At the moment we do not know when they were born or how they came to be in the car park.

"We’re extremely concerned for the welfare of the baby’s mother, and urgently appealing for her or anyone who knows who she is to come forward."

Det Insp Jim Edmonds, from the force's public protection unit, said: “This is a truly tragic discovery, and we’ve been treating the scene and the baby with the utmost care and dignity today.

“While we don’t yet know what has happened, what we do know is that there must be a mother out there who is in real need of help − and she is my absolute priority at the moment."

Later on they revealed that they had found the mother as a result of the appeal and "she is now receiving appropriate care."

They added: "We will be speaking to her in due course.

"Thank you to everyone for sharing the appeal."
